the percentage or number of eligible voters who actually cast their vote
- The election saw a high voter turnout, with over 75% of eligible voters participating.
- Low turnout in the last referendum raised concerns about public engagement.
- The campaign focused on boosting turnout among young voters.
- Record turnout was achieved during the presidential election, reflecting strong public interest.
- Efforts to increase voter turnout included extending polling hours and providing transportation.
